As stated above , Deng could be gone after this season - And, for as good as he is/could be, banking on McRob in the future is no sure thing - the injuries could continue and/or get worst. As good as those guys can be, there are reasons to be skeptical if they can be apart of our future.

Even trading Bosh wouldnt be a smart move - For as good as Hassan has been, lets remember its only been a fairly small sample size - lets see what he can do for the rest of the season, and with a full NBA season under his belt, which wont be this season since he has bounced around from NBA to D-League.

More importantly, until Wade is gone you really are going to be able to improve on your roster- He is no longer a guy you can build a team around and think you are going to get anywhere.

With Hassan, Johnson, Napier, Ennis , Hamilton all getting some playing time last night, we got a glimpse of the youth movement for the Heat - thats where the Heat are at right now - they are in between trying to add players to make a push for a title and having to go young to rebuild/reload mode.

But when you are paying CB as much money as you are, and overpaying for Diva as much as you are - there isnt much you can do.
